The goal is to help Wilbur pass a series of alien tests to prove humanity is sentient and save Earth from becoming a fast-food source.
The game was developed by Sanctuary Woods, a company known for its focus on multimedia and narrative-driven titles.
It is a classic point-and-click adventure game focused on solving logic puzzles, exploring environments, and engaging in dialogue.
Yes, the game features a time-loop mechanic where Wilbur must repeat certain sequences to find the correct solution.
The story is highly humorous and satirical, poking fun at corporate culture and science fiction tropes.

The main character is Wilbur, a regular guy who is unexpectedly abducted by the Orion Burger corporation.
Yes, the game is a full talkie, meaning all the dialogue is voiced, which enhances the characterization and humor.

The puzzles are clever and require logical thinking, but the time-loop system allows players to learn from mistakes and progress.
